History of Digital Wallets
The history of digital wallets dates back to the late 1990s wjen the first online payment systems emerged. These early platforms allowed users to make purchases over the internet. This innovation was groundbreaking. It paved the way for more sophisticated solutions.
In the 2000s, mobile technology advanced significantly. As a termination, digital wallets began to integrate with smartphones. This integration enhanced user accessibility . It made transactions more convenient.
By the 2010s, major companies launched their own digital wallet services. These included PayPal, Apple Pay, and Google Wallet. Their popularity surged, reflecting a shift in consumer behavior. People preferred faster, more secure payment methods.
Types of Digital Wallets
Digital wallets can be categorized into several types. Each type serves distinct purposes and functionalities. The main categories include:
Closed Wallets: These are specific to a single merchant. Users can only use them within that ecosystem. This limits flexibility.
Semi-Closed Wallets: These allow transactions at multiple merchants. However, they may restrict cash withdrawals. This offers more options.
Open Wallets: These enable transactions across various platforms. Users can also withdraw cash from ATMs. This provides maximum convenience.

How Digital Wallets Work
Technology Behind Digital Wallets
Digital wallets utilize advanced technology to facilitate transactions. They rely on encryption to secure sensitive data. This ensures user information remains confidential. Security is paramount in financial transactions.
Additionally, digital wallets employ tokenization. This process replaces sensitive data with unique identifiers. It minimizes the risk of fraud. Users can transact with confidence.

Cryptocurrency Wallets Explained
Cryptocurrency wallets are essential for managing digital assets. They put in private keys necessary for transactions. This security is crucial for protecting investments. He must understand wallet types.
There are hot wallets and cold wallets. Hot wallets are connected to the internet. Cold wallets are offline storage solutions. Each has distinct advantages and risks.

Case Studies of Successful Implementations
Successful implementations of digital wallets can be observed in various regions. For instance, Alipay in China has transformed payment methods. It integrates seamlessly with e-commerce platforms. This has significantly increased user engagement.
Similarly, Paytm in India has expanded financial inclusion. It offers services beyond payments, such as loans and insurance. This diversification is impressive. It enhances user loyalty and trust.
